Promo overload

I found it pretty amusing to have the USGA pound us with “While We’re Young” and “Tee It Forward” promos during the U.S. Open in an effort to speed up the game.

They had plenty of opportunity to run their ads because it took five and a half hours for most groups to negotiate Merion’s 18 holes.

If you really want to speed up a round of golf and make each golfer’s experience more pleasant , your Beacon scribe has a better idea. In order for it to catch on, I will have to come up with a fancy name or slogan to get everyone’s attention. How about “Hit and Git?”

What does that mean? First, let me tell you what it doesn’t mean. It does not mean “hit your shot, wipe off your club with your towel, put the head cover back on and place it back in your bag.”

The rules of “Hit and Git” are simple: execute your shot, keep club in hand, get in the cart and go to the ball; when you get to it, you may perform the above maintenance.

This way the group behind you doesn’t have to watch as you clean up after your shot, they can be busy hitting their ball. I don’t know how much time this will save, but it will eliminate aggravating the group behind you.

Pretty simple, try it.

Catching up with Cailin Bullett

What has Cailin BullettĀ been up to since graduating from Colby Sawyer College?

The daughter of former Drury and Worcester State standout Tom Bullett and granddaughter of broadcasting legend Bucky Bullett was named North Atlantic Conference Woman of the Year for her academic and basketball achievements.

She is the only player in program history to record 1000 points, 500 rebounds and 500 assists.

Oh yeah, she also recently returned from Italy, where her USA team was 4-1 on a five-city tour.
